§ 28-1252 — Fireworks; State Fire Marshal; rules and regulations; enforcement of sections

The State Fire Marshal shall adopt and promulgate reasonable
rules and regulations for the enforcement of sections 28-1239.01 and 28-1241
to 28-1252 and, together with all peace officers of the state and its political
subdivisions, shall be charged with the enforcement of sections 28-1239.01
and 28-1243 to 28-1252 .
